This recipe is perfect for warm days when you want something sweet but not fussy to prepare.

The method is straightforward and requires only a few cold ingredients and basic kitchen tools. There’s no ice cream maker needed—whipping the cream and folding it into the soda‑and‑condensed milk mixture creates a luxuriously smooth base that freezes into a soft, scoopable treat.

Heavy cream gives the ice cream a rich mouthfeel, while sweetened condensed milk adds sweetness and body that balance the Dr Pepper flavor. The soda contributes its signature aromatic profile and a hint of fizz that lightens the overall texture. Ingredients :
1½ cups Heavy cream, cold
1 cup Condensed milk, cold
½ cup Dr Pepper soda, cold
½ tsp Vanilla extract
A pinch of salt

How to make Dr Pepper ice cream :
Step 1. Place two mixing bowls and a whisk in the freezer for 10–15 minutes to chill.

Step 2. In a cold mixing bowl, combine the Dr Pepper and condensed milk. Whisk until smooth and slightly frothy.

Step 3. In the second chilled bowl, whip the heavy cream with the vanilla extract and a pinch of salt until soft peaks form.

Step 4. Gently fold the whipped cream into the Dr Pepper and condensed milk mixture until fully combined, keeping the mixture light and airy.
Step 5. Transfer the mixture to a freezer‑safe container, cover, and freeze for at least 4 hours, or until firm.

Step 6. Scoop and serve. Enjoy straight, on a cone, or as part of a float.
